YouthBridge Community Foundation is a community foundation based in Saint Louis, Missouri, serving the greater St. Louis region. The organization operates as a 501(c)(3) public charity and functions as a bridge between donors and nonprofit organizations, particularly those serving children and families in the region.

Mission & Focus Areas
Mission: Partner with donors to help charities in the St. Louis region, especially those focused on children, through leadership, grants and donor services.
Vision: For all children to have services available to help them become healthy, productive adults.
The foundation's work encompasses:
- Building strong and vibrant communities through capacity building and philanthropy initiatives
- Technical assistance for nonprofit organizations
- Capacity building grants and programs
- Endowment building and administration
- Philanthropy assistance and training
- Donor-advised fund administration
Primary funding areas include Education,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, and Human Services, with geographic focus primarily in Missouri, Florida, and New York.
Grantmaking
The foundation operates a donor-advised fund through which donors can direct the distribution or investment of funds.

Financial History
Multi-year comparison from IRS filings
As of 2024:
- Total Assets: $105,238,300
- Net Assets: $100,166,211
- Total Revenue: $11,240,983
- Total Expenses: $21,848,076
- Total Liabilities: $3,750,000
Financial Stability: The foundation maintains a long tradition as a strong, stable organization with sound financial management. Over its 100+ year history, it has successfully built a modest endowment that, along with earned income, provides funds for grants, community programs, and operating expenses.
The organization is a corporation in good standing with the Missouri Secretary of State and undergoes annual audits by RubinBrown LLP. Financial service relationships include Commerce Bank and Commerce Trust Company.
Investment Services: Through Commerce Trust Company, YouthBridge provides access to pooled investment options for fundholders.
